ESSENTIAL D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Perform work as outlined in repair order.
  • Verify warranty, if applicable, on all repair orders.
  • Perform all work with efficiency and accuracy and in accordance with dealership and factory standards.
  • Diagnose and repair vehicle malfunction.
  • Communicate with the parts department to secure necessary parts.
  • Save and tag warranty parts.
  • Advise shop foreman and provide recommendation if repair order needs to be adjusted. 
  • Repair documented in technician comments during each active time punch.
  • Road test vehicles as needed for quality assessment.
  • Maintain working knowledge of factory technical bulletins.
  • Ensure customer vehicle cleanliness.
  • Maintain neat and orderly work area.
  • Accountable for all dealership owned tools.
  • Uphold federal, state and local regulations governing the disposal of hazardous waste.
  • Perform job duties and functions with flexibility in the event circumstances shift, i.e., emergencies, changes in personnel, workload, rush jobs or technology developments.
  • Other duties as assigned by the manager.

WORK ENVIRONMENT & PHYSICAL ABILITIES:

  • Required to perform work inside and outside, in all-weather situations, at the shop division location.
  • Requires frequent sitting, standing, balancing, bending or stooping for prolonged periods of time.
  • Manual dexterity, fine manipulation and the ability to reach with hands and arms and lift up to 80 lbs.
  • Must be able to operate simple to complex and heavy-duty machinery.
  • Normal range of hearing and vision.

REQUIRED EDUCATION, EXPERIENCE, KNOWLEDGE & SKILLS:

  • High school diploma or equivalent.
  • Valid Driver's License and MVR in good standing.
  • Candidate must have experience diagnosing and repairing passenger automobiles.
  • Dealership experience a plus!
  • Candidate must be a motivated individual who can work independently.
  • Familiarity with all aspects of gas and diesel truck repair and maintenance including; engine repair, transmission repair, drivability and electrical diagnostics, suspension, brake systems, etc.
  • Proficient in appropriate computer information systems including Tech II and SI2000 (GMC Chevrolet).
  • Candidate must possess a complete set of hand tools with rollaway toolbox.
  • Excellent verbal and communication skills.
  • Detail oriented.
  • Ability to successfully complete a General Abilities Assessment and pass post-offer background check, physical and drug screening.
